Selenium is one of the widely popular tools used for web UI automation. It is open-source code and its library is used in various programming languages to perform Web UI automation testing. Python is one of them.
Introduction to Selenium
Selenium software is used to perform an automated testing framework to validate web applications across various browsers. It is also used to test any mobile applications. Selenium has several training features that promote your career to a better future.
The Selenium online automation testing courses are currently in the hit list of all the software testers. Selenium is an open-source tool that is used to test web applications and mobile app development. Selenium testing provides a wide range of job opportunities for the youngsters who are all looking to explore their career in the field of software development and testing.
Selenium software uses multiple tools to perform selenium testing. Some of its tool lists include Selenium Integrated Development Environment (IDE), Selenium Grid, Selenium Remote Control (RC), and Web Driver. The testing done with the help of the selenium tool is called Selenium testing.
Choose Selenium Online training
Selenium test engineers are great in demand in the IT industry. To shine your career in selenium all you must do is join Certified Professional Selenium Training and get certified to become a professional tester.
Selenium supports multiple programming languages like Java, C#, python, etc to create selenium scripts. For the IT background professionals, it is easy to learn the selenium test as the programming language used is similar. It helps the tester to automate testing web-based applications effectively and efficiently.
What you’ll learn in an online automation testing course?
- By the end of the course, the learner will be able to build selenium automated tests using selenium web driver python API.
- You learn how to install selenium on different browsers and platforms.
- You know how to locate web elements using CSS selectors.
- You learn how to leverage concepts like oops and UI mapping to maintain the test codes.
- Most importantly, the learner learns how to apply actions to the web elements and how to queue selenium actions using Action chains.
- The learners learn how to collect the selenium test without a manual test suite file.
- At the end of the course, you will learn how to organize selenium test codes in the package and wrap the selenium calls.
Brief Introduction to Selenium Tools
By learning the automation testing training course online, the learner gets a brief introduction about selenium tools and its operation method. The following are the Selenium tools used for testing various browser applications. Let’s see one by one.
Selenium IDE: The Integrated Development Environment (IDE) of Selenium is a Firefox plug-in that is used to do testing on Firefox browser applications. It offers a graphical UI that records a user’s Firefox actions. Selenium IDE supports only the Firefox browser and other browsers are not supported by IDE.
Selenium RC: Selenium Remote Control (RC) is a flagship testing framework that allows the user to perform simple browser action and linear execution. It is greatly supported by programming languages like Java, Python, Perl, etc. that merely perform complex tests.
Selenium Web Driver: Selenium Web Driver is the successor of Selenium remote control. It is used to send the commands directly to the browser and the results are retrieved from the browser applications.
Selenium Grid: Selenium Grid is an important tool used in the Selenium testing process to run tests parallel across different devices and browsers. It greatly helps to save execution time and work.
Introduction to Python
The major benefit of learning Selenium training near me is it doesn’t require any license to work with the browser. Any learner can start with UI and do testing practice right at their home. Python plays a major role in Selenium testing. Now let’s see why python is necessary for Selenium testing?
Python is the most powerful language used in Certified Professional Selenium Training for the benefits of the learner. Python is simple to learn and easy to use. The programming language of pythons resembles the English Language. It is a free open source language that supports the tester for easy access and fast workflows.
Python has many in-built testing tools that cover automated debugging concepts. The python has a lot of tools and modules to work with various applications for convenient testing and a faster approval.
For testing with cross-platform and cross-browser, selenium testing and splinter testing are used with automated frameworks to do PyTest. To get in-depth knowledge about these tools and modules all you need to do is join the automation testing course online and explore the knowledge of python and its frameworks.
Advantages of Selenium and python
- Selenium and python are open source tool
- It can be executed in desktop and laptops
- It can execute scripts across different browsers
- It doesn’t require any license to perform the testing task
- It can also support mobile devices.
- It executes tests within the browser and there is no focus needed during script execution.
- The scripts can be executed on different OS with the help of the tools and modules.
- The selenium tester supports any programming languages for its operation.
- The job opportunities are available globally.
Flexibility
The software tester always looks for flexibility in their work. While choosing online learning Selenium training near me, the learner gets the flexibility to design test cases either in programming logic or in a playback approach.
Online learning helps the learner to balance the work with the course and do testing practice near to the geographical location. The python based Selenium testing comforts software tester to perform his job efficiently. Use Selenium IDE to record the test and export later in a programming language to execute a web driver test.
Huge Demand for Selenium Testers
In today’s trend, everything becomes online and hence the usage of Selenium grows consistently and the demand for selenium testers grows proportionately. Start to search for the best automation testing courses online and join today for a colorful future.